The fight between Jon Jones e Rashad evans, valid for the UFC light heavyweight belt, is increasingly full of controversies every day. The Americans, who were once teammates and are currently declared rivals, face off in the main fight of UFC 145, an event scheduled to take place next Saturday (21), in Las Vegas, in the United States. And the long-awaited duel got a new appetizer this week.

In an unprecedented action, UFC will be Jon Jones' main sponsor and stamps his brand on the shorts worn by the current champion of the category. Shortly after confirming the sponsorship, Evans commented on the case. Without getting into controversy, the challenger stated that the organization favors Jones.
“It looks like they picked the guy they want to support. I can't say much about it, I'll just do what I need to do. I don’t worry too much about it,” Rashad told The MMA Hour. “They are (favoring Jones), but it doesn’t matter. That doesn’t bother me,” commented Evans, in an interview with the North American program MMA Hour
